Deklaracja funkcji w C++ Builder - PROBLEM :(

0

Witam

Mam problem z deklaracja funkcji w C++ Builderze...
Moze to trywialna sprawa dla kogos, ale jestem dosc poczatkujacy w "obiektach" i nie wychodzi mi to w ten sposob, jak robilem wczesniej.
Wiec mam pytanie.
Jak zadeklarowac w BUILDERZE funkcję typu void, ktora nic nie musi zwracac?
czy tak:
void funkcja(void)
{
}

ale jak tak robie to wywala mi error: E2141 Declaration syntax error.

Dopiero jak dam srednik za funkcja
void funkcja(void);
to niby sie uruchamia.. ale przeciez to nie jest prawidlowe (chyba ;/)

Prosze rowniez o przyklad wywolania funkcji

o ile mi sie wydaje powinno byc:
funkcja();
ale czy na pewno?

0

W Builderze funkcje deklaruje sie tak samo jak w C++ czy w C. Dobrze ja deklarujesz, dobrze wywolujesz ale widocznie wywolujesz ja przed deklaracja. Prototyp funkcji na poczatku kodu programu powinien rozwiazac Twoj problem.

0
GEGE napisał(a)

na poczatku kodu programu

w pliku anglowkowym byloby jeszcze seksowniej :d ale to juz kwestia formalna

1 użytkowników online, w tym zalogowanych: 0, gości: 1